游戏制作需要一系列的软件工具,这些工具覆盖了从策划、设计到编程和音效制作的各个环节。以下是一些关键的软件工具:
游戏引擎
Unity3D:一个跨平台的游戏引擎,支持2D和3D游戏开发,广泛用于移动和桌面游戏开发。
Unreal Engine:一个强大的游戏引擎,适用于开发AAA级别的游戏,以其高质量的图形和强大的功能著称。
Cocos2d-x:一个开源的游戏开发框架,支持2D游戏开发,适用于移动和桌面平台。
3D建模和动画软件
Blender:一个免费且开源的3D建模、动画、渲染和后期制作软件,适用于游戏开发。
Maya:一款专业的3D建模、动画和渲染软件,广泛应用于电影、电视和游戏制作。
3ds Max:由Autodesk公司开发的3D建模、动画和渲染软件,适用于游戏、电影和广告等领域。
ZBrush:一款数字雕刻软件,用于创建高细节度的3D模型,常用于游戏角色和道具的设计。
2D图像和动画软件
Adobe Photoshop:一款强大的图像编辑软件,用于创建和编辑游戏中的2D图像素材。
GIMP:一个免费且开源的图像编辑软件,具有与Photoshop类似的功能。
Pixlr:一款在线图像编辑工具,提供类似于Photoshop的界面和功能。
音频和音效制作软件
Audacity:一个免费且开源的音频编辑软件,适用于制作简单的音效和背景音乐。
Adobe Audition:一款专业的音频编辑和混音软件,适用于制作高质量的游戏音效。
游戏策划和制作软件
Microsoft Office:包括Word、Excel、PowerPoint等,用于编写游戏文档、策划和项目管理。
MindManager:一款思维导图软件,帮助策划人员组织和呈现游戏设计思路。
RPG Maker:一系列用于制作角色扮演游戏的软件,如RPG Maker VX和RPG Maker 3000。
其他辅助工具
ConceptArt.org:一个在线概念艺术和纹理设计工具,提供丰富的素材和模板。
Substance Painter:一款专业的3D纹理绘制软件,适用于游戏角色的皮肤和表面细节制作。
Kodu Game Lab:一个可视化编程语言环境,适合儿童和初学者进行游戏开发。
建议
选择合适的游戏制作软件应根据你的具体需求、技能水平和项目规模来决定。如果你是初学者,可以从一些入门级的引擎和工具开始,如Unity3D和Blender,它们提供了丰富的教程和社区支持。随着经验的积累,你可以逐渐尝试使用更专业的工具和软件,如Unreal Engine和Maya,以提升游戏开发的效率和质量。